What Is a Defective Product Lawyer and Why Do You Need One?
A defective product lawyer is a plaintiff's attorney who focuses exclusively on product liability claims — legal actions filed against companies responsible for putting dangerous goods on the market when their products harm unsuspecting consumers. This legal specialty draws on both federal regulations and state-specific legal standards to hold corporations responsible.
From a procedural standpoint, a defective product lawyer investigates three primary theories: manufacturing defects, a dangerous problem baked into every unit produced, and a failure to warn consumers of known risks. Every pathway requires different evidence. Our attorneys assess which theory applies based on what the evidence shows.
Beyond identifying the theory of liability, a defective product lawyer also handles gathering physical evidence from the defective item, commissioning expert reports from engineers and medical professionals, and calculating the full extent of your damages. Who Is a Good Candidate a Defective Product Lawyer?
You may have a strong product liability claim if you were injured by an item that malfunctioned during normal use. People who benefit most from working with a defective product lawyer include individuals injured by items the manufacturer knew were dangerous, victims of pharmaceutical side effects that weren't disclosed, those involved in accidents caused by a defective car part, and consumers who followed all instructions and still got hurt.
Unlike some legal claims, these cases don't require showing deliberate wrongdoing — the legal framework governing these claims mean a company can be held responsible simply because the product was defective and caused harm, regardless of whether they were careless or knew about the flaw. This legal standard works in your favor that a knowledgeable defective product lawyer will use to your benefit.
There are cases where product liability may not be the right avenue, misuse of a product is a defense that manufacturers frequently raise. It's also worth noting that, injuries with very minor financial impact might not warrant pursuing a lawsuit. What financial recovery can a defective product lawyer recover for me?
What you can recover typically includes hospital bills, rehabilitation, and future treatment costs, lost wages and reduced earning capacity, the non-economic toll the injury has taken, any personal property destroyed by the defective item, and in egregious circumstances, additional penalties designed to punish the defendant.

What steps should I take immediately after getting hurt by a defective product?
What you do in the hours and days following your accident matter more than most people realize. Seek medical attention immediately — treatment records become key evidence. Preserve the product and any packaging or instructions. Take pictures of your wounds and the product, write down exactly what happened while details are fresh, and call our office without delay.
